Transaction ba575792db4ac3aa4529a72f35a04282ec9be76243d117d36d165d68529fc024

block
dc7a6cb30d0f9b8c9e181532d1d5b3ea30483c60e765bf22d8cdfe2ed44827b6

1 Input

23 Outputs